Experiences and Side Effects of Phenylephrine 10mg/ml Injection
Hello, I am looking for some personal experiences and insights regarding the use of Phenylephrine 10mg/ml Injection. I understand that it is commonly used in hospital settings to raise blood pressure, especially when it drops too low during surgery or in certain medical conditions. It can also be used to treat a fast heart rhythm called PSVT. I am aware of the side effects, but I am curious to know how common they are and how severe they can be. I am particularly interested in knowing about the tissue damage that can occur at the injection site. Has anyone here had to deal with this? What were the symptoms, and how was it managed? Additionally, I would love to hear about any lesser-known side effects or tips for managing them. Thank you in advance for sharing your experiences!

I've seen this used quite a bit in the ER for hypotension. The most common side effects I've seen are dizziness and headache, which usually resolve on their own. But yeah, the injection site can sometimes get red and painful. Just keep an eye on it and let your nurse know if it gets worse.

I'm an anesthesiologist, and I can tell you that the risk of severe side effects is actually quite low, especially if the drug is administered properly. The key is to monitor the patient closely and adjust the dosage as needed. But yeah, tissue damage at the injection site is a real thing, so it's important to check that regularly.

I'm a nurse, and I've seen this drug used a lot, but the tissue damage is pretty rare. Most of the time, patients just get a little redness around the injection site. It's usually not a big deal, but you should definitely tell your nurse if you notice anything unusual.
